02 · Digital Twin

The line becomes
a living model.

The digital twin synchronizes equipment states, product positions and process conditions in real time. It creates the common spatial and temporal reference for all subsequent intelligence.

03 · Process Intelligence

AI supported by
engineering knowledge.

HFsmart and the other applications do not evaluate isolated values. Statistical methods, machine learning and physical process models work together to identify causes and explain their impact.

05 · Traceability

Every product receives
its digital history.

The Digital Product Passport documents material, thermal history, process parameters, model results and final quality status for every part, coil or batch.
